/* This file contains routines that perform vector multiplication.
 */
#include "cmp.h"
#include "cmppriv.h"
#include "cmpspprt.h"

#ifndef __VECTOR_ASSEMBLY
/* vectorB = (scaler * vectorA) + vectorB
     Begin vectorA at the indexA'th CMPWord and continue for lengthA CMPWords.
     Begin vectorB at the indexB'th CMPWord.
 */
void
CMP_VectorMultiply(CMPWord scaler, CMPInt *vectorA, int indexA, int lengthA,
		   CMPInt *vectorB, int indexB)
{
    register CMPWord carry, *valueA, *valueB;
    register CMPWord lowProd1, lowProd2, highProd1, highProd2;

    valueA = &(CMP_PINT_WORD (vectorA, indexA));
    valueB = &(CMP_PINT_WORD (vectorB, indexB));

    /* Initialize carry to 0. */
    carry = (CMPWord)0;

    if ((--lengthA) & 1) {
	CMP_MULT_HIGHLOW(scaler, *valueA, lowProd1, highProd1);
	valueA++;
	lowProd1 += *valueB;
	highProd1 += (lowProd1 < *valueB);
	lowProd1 += carry;
	highProd1 += (lowProd1 < carry);
	carry = highProd1;
	    
	*valueB = lowProd1;
	valueB++;
	lengthA--;
    }
    CMP_MULT_HIGHLOW(scaler, *valueA, lowProd1, highProd1);
    valueA++;
    while(lengthA) {
	CMP_MULT_HIGHLOW(scaler, *valueA, lowProd2, highProd2);
	valueA++;
	/* Inner product:
	   (highProd, lowProd) =
	   scaler * valueA[loopCount] + valueB[loopCount] + carry
	   Then set valueB[loopCount] to lowProd and carry (for the next
	   iteration) to highProd.
	   */
	lowProd1 += *valueB;
	highProd1 += (lowProd1 < *valueB);
	lowProd1 += carry;
	highProd1 += (lowProd1 < carry);
	carry = highProd1;
	    
	*valueB = lowProd1;
	valueB++;

	CMP_MULT_HIGHLOW(scaler, *valueA, lowProd1, highProd1);
	valueA++;
	/* Inner product:
	       (highProd, lowProd) =
	       scaler * valueA[loopCount] + valueB[loopCount] + carry
	       Then set valueB[loopCount] to lowProd and carry (for the next
	       iteration) to highProd.
	       */
	lowProd2 += *valueB;
	highProd2 += (lowProd2 < *valueB);
	lowProd2 += carry;
	highProd2 += (lowProd2 < carry);
	carry = highProd2;
	    
	*valueB = lowProd2;
	valueB++;
	lengthA -= 2;
    }
    lowProd1 += *valueB;
    highProd1 += (lowProd1 < *valueB);
    lowProd1 += carry;
    highProd1 += (lowProd1 < carry);
    carry = highProd1;
	    
    *valueB = lowProd1;
    valueB++;


    /* loopCount now = lengthA. */
    *valueB += carry;

    /* If adding in the final carry leads to a carry itself, then propagate.
     */
    if (*valueB < carry) {
	valueB++;
	while (*valueB == CMP_WORD_MASK) {
	    *valueB = 0;
	    valueB++;
	}
	(*valueB)++;
    }
    return;
}

/* Square each element of vectorA, adding the result to two elements
     of vectorB. This is used in squaring two CMPInt's.
 */
void
CMP_AddInTrace(CMPInt *vectorA, CMPInt *vectorB)
{
    int lenA;
    register CMPWord carry, lowProd, highProd, *valueA, *valueB;

    lenA = CMP_PINT_LENGTH(vectorA);
    valueA = CMP_PINT_VALUE (vectorA);
    valueB = CMP_PINT_VALUE (vectorB);
    carry = (CMPWord)0;

    /* Square one word of vectorA, then add the resulting two words to
       two words from montSquare. This should never overflow.
       */
    while(lenA--) {
	CMP_SQUARE_HIGHLOW(*valueA, lowProd, highProd);
	valueA++;

	lowProd += *valueB;
	if (lowProd < *valueB)
	    highProd++;

	lowProd += carry;
	if (lowProd < carry)
	    highProd++;

	*valueB = lowProd;
	valueB++;
	highProd += *valueB;
	carry = (highProd < *valueB) ? 1 : 0;
	*valueB = highProd;
	valueB++;
    }
    if (carry == 0)
	return;

    /* Propagate carry.
     */
    while (*valueB == CMP_WORD_MASK) {
	*valueB = 0;
	valueB++;
    }
    (*valueB)++;
    return;
}
#endif /* __VECTOR_ASSEMBLY */
